3dsjs

金属丝过量检测器(12x6x6mm微型开关与滚筒组成)

Filament Runout Sensor using 12x6x6mm Micro Switch with Roller

2023-06-27 18:40:47

使用说明

  1. 所有模型资源均由用户上传分享,内容来源于网络公开资源
  2. 侵权投诉:通过抖音私信 @jobsfan 联系我们(需附版权证明),24小时内处理
  3. 模型将通过邮件发送(5分钟内自动发货),感谢理解带宽压力
关于费用

我们是爱好者共建社区,为维持服务器成本,每个模型收取微量费用(仅覆盖基础开支)。我们承诺最低成本运营,感谢您的支持!

扫码手机访问
抖音私信 @jobsfan

Summary

Wanted to make a filament sensor using the smallest switch.
Didn't find any with a roller and no extra parts, that also had a supertight gap enabling flexible filament use. So i made my own.

I opted for using the smallest microswitch I could find with a roller.
Microswitch Specification:
Color: Black
Rating:1A 125V AC
Operating Temperature: -25°C to +65°C
Contact Resistance: ≤30MΩ
Insulation Resistance: ≥100MW
Withstand Voltage: AC 300V/min
Life:≤5,000,000
Dimensions: 12mm(0.47") x 6mm(0.23") x 6mm(0.23")
Pitch: 6.5mm
SPDT contacts
PCB solder terminals

Designed for a 2pin JST-XH Header.

BOM:
1x - Microswitch with roller (12x6x6mm)
1x - 2pin JST-XH Header
3x - m3x18mm screws if you want to use nuts on the backside, 12-16 if you want to rely on threaded plastic
1x - short wire

Assembly:

  • Insert a 2pin JST-XH connector into the 2pin JST-XH header (this alleviates issues with melting and bending).
  • Bend one pin of the JST-XH so it almost touches the pin on the microswitch (pictured)
  • Solder a bridge between the JST-XH pin and the microswitch (pictured)
  • Solder a wire from the NC pin to the remaining pin on the JST-XH connector
  • use cyanoacrylate glue (CA) to glue the JST-XH header in place.
  • Make a wire with a 2pin JST-XH connector on the end, and whatever you need to connect it to your controller board at the other end. (Polarity doesn't matter).
  • Use the chamfer tool and a knife to chamfer the outside edge of the input PTFE tube
  • Use a countersink bit to chamfer the inside edge of the output PTFE tube

Klipper Macro:

Custom Filament Runout Switch Sensor

https://docs.vorondesign.com/community/electronics/120decibell/filament_runout_sensor.html

Change switch_pin to your pin

Make sure you have M600 already.

This is set up to resume manually after changing filament

[filament_switch_sensor filament_sensor_bowden]
pause_on_runout: True
runout_gcode:
M117 Out of Filament
M600
insert_gcode:
M117 Filament Detected, ready to resume

RESUME_MACRO

event_delay: 3.0
pause_delay: 0.5
switch_pin: PG11 # CHANGE THIS TO YOUR PIN

Fusion360 Design File included for easy remixing.

Print settings:
Orientation: Print with arrows facing down.
Filament: PLA (or ABS if used inside a chamber)
Nozzle Size: 0.4mm
Layer height: 0.2mm or less
Parts are simple, No support, No Brim, raft or anything needed

Tags

License

Filament Runout Sensor using 12x6x6mm Micro Switch with Roller
by Mickey_J is licensed under the GNU - GPL license.

金属丝过量检测器(12x6x6mm微型开关与滚筒组成)
朋友,你觉得上面这个模型,属于下面的哪个分类?
必须全中文,且长度不超过15

相关内容

猜你喜欢